2nd Annual Compliance Conference

03 March 2010 | People and Companies | Events | Intelligence Transfer Centre

As a compliance stakeholder you are faced with the pressure of identifying which of the many pieces of legislation you should comply with. Find out what you have to put in place from the start to finish in creating a well monitored, error-free compliance process to avoid penalties and litigation.

Key issues that will be covered include:

• Mapping out your current compliance requirements from start to finish
• King 3 requirement in terms of compliance
• What is the minimum standard and educational requirement suitable for a compliance officer
• Key elements and legislation that make up a sustainable compliance programme
• Evaluating various frameworks and objectives necessary to align compliance directives to implementation
• PPI- Key focus areas to ensure compliance
• Update on FAIS- 6years on
• How to monitoring and control your compliance efforts effectively
• CPA- How to strike the balance between consumer protection and business risk
